Product Description: This compound is primarily recognized for its role in immunology and pharmacology, particularly as an immune response modifier. It is used to stimulate the body's immune system, enhancing its ability to fight off infections and diseases. Specifically, it has been studied for its potential in treating viral infections, certain types of cancer, and skin conditions. In dermatology, it is applied topically to manage actinic keratosis, a pre-cancerous skin condition, and has shown efficacy in reducing the risk of skin cancer development. Additionally, its immunomodulatory properties make it a candidate for vaccine adjuvants, improving the efficacy of vaccines by boosting the immune response. Research continues to explore its broader therapeutic applications, including its use in autoimmune diseases and as an antiviral agent.
